欢迎来到奥多码
ASP.Net Core3.0中使用JWT认证的实现
JWT认证简单介绍 关于Jwt的介绍网上很多,此处不在赘述,我们主要看看jwt的结构。 JWT主要由三部分组成,如下: HEADER.PAYLOAD.SIGNATURE HEADER包含token的元数据,主要是加密算法,和签名的类型,如下面的信息,说明了 加密的对象类型是JWT,加密算法是HMACSHA-256...…
ASP.NET Cookie是怎么生成的(推荐)
可能有人知道Cookie的生成由machineKey有关,machineKey用于决定Cookie生成的算法和密钥,并如果使用多台服务器做负载均衡时,必须指定一致的machineKey用于解密,那么这个过程到底是怎样的呢? 如果需要在.NETCore中使用ASP.NETCookie,本文将提到的内容也将是一些必经之路。...…
ASP.NET MVC中使用log4net的实现示例
今天自己要弄一个日志记录功能,以前也弄过但是都忘了,今天又弄了一下花了几十分钟,在此记录一下 第一步:添加log4net.dll 第二步:配置 示例如下:我是直接配置在了Web.config下 <?xmlversion="1.0"encoding="utf-8"?> <c...…
asp.net core 授权详解
IAuthorizeDate接口代表了授权系统的源头: publicinterfaceIAuthorizeData { stringPolicy{get;set;} stringRoles{get;set;} stringAuthenticationSchemes{get;set;} } 接口中定义的三个属性分别...…
从EFCore上下文的使用到深入剖析DI的生命周期最后实现自动属性注入
Asp.Net Core Identity 隐私数据保护的实现
前言 Asp.NetCoreIdentity是Asp.NetCore的重要组成部分,他为Asp.NetCore甚至其他.NetCore应用程序提供了一个简单易用且易于扩展的基础用户管理系统框架。它包含了基本的用户、角色、第三方登录、Claim等功能,使用IdentityServer4可以为其轻松扩展OpenIdconn...…
前言 我们一般可以在Linux服务器上执行dotnet<app_assembly.dll>命令来运行我们的.netCoreWebApi应用。但是这样运行起来的应用很不稳定,关闭终端窗口之后,应用也会停止运行。为了让其可以稳定运行,我们需要让它变成系统的守护进程,成为一种服务一直在系统中运行,出现异常时也能...…
.Net Core3 用Windows 桌面应用开发Asp.Net Core网站
前言 曾经在开发Asp.Net网站时就在想,为什么一定要把网站挂到IIS上?网站项目的Main函数哪儿去了?后来才知道这个Main函数在w3wp.exe里,这也是IIS的主进程。Asp.Net网站的命门被IIS捏着,我无力改变。有时需要临时搭建一个简单的Web服务器,去网上一通度娘,发现了MyWebServer、HFS...…
在Asp.Net Core中使用ModelConvention实现全局过滤器隔离
从何说起 这来自于我把项目迁移到Asp.NetCore的过程中碰到一个问题。在一个web程序中同时包含了MVC和WebAPI,现在需要给WebAPI部分单独添加一个接口验证过滤器IActionFilter,常规做法一般是写好过滤器后给需要的控制器挂上这个标签,高级点的做法是注册一个全局过滤器,这样可以避免每次手动添加同...…
使用.Net Core编写命令行工具(CLI)的方法
命令行工具(CLI) 命令行工具(CLI)是在图形用户界面得到普及之前使用最为广泛的用户界面,它通常不支持鼠标,用户通过键盘输入指令,计算机接收到指令后,予以执行。 通常认为,命令行工具(CLI)没有图形用户界面(GUI)那么方便用户操作。因为,命令行工具的软件通常需要用户记忆操作的命令,但是,由于其本身的特点,命令行...…
  • 在线客服

    官方微信

    仅处理投诉、举报及平台使用问题;
    商品问题请咨询商家客服!

浏览记录